The more it snows, tiddlypom

One minute it was bright sunshine, the next minute it was snow. Not just a few flaky bits of snow, proper snow, the type we rarely see in these Climactically Warming Times. So we did what all sensible people do in the snow - put on our jackets, grabbed the camera and slipped and slid our way down to the seafront for a cuppa.
.
We often go to the Wish Tower Tea Room on the seafront for a Sunday morning warmer; it's a bit tatty and is aimed at the more aged market, but they do a reasonable cup of coffee and sell some spendid cakes covered in marzipan. And there is a great view of the beach from the rather faded sunroom. The view on this occasion was somewhat whiter than normal, with snow covering everything, including the beach down to the water's edge and the tops of the groynes. I've lived in Eastbourne for all of my 32 years and I've never seen snow like it.

Squeaky Cat had a great deal of fun negotiating the fence outside the kitchen; the kittens popped their heads outside, trod on the snow, growled at it and then ran back indoors ! So cute ! Monica decided that the best place for a kitten in the snow is safely stowed in the cat bed, on top of the oven. Our Dowager Duchess cat Bubble, who is far too grand for these childish carries-on, slept peacefully through all the excitement.

The snow didn't last long, but lasted long enough for me to get a couple of pictures of our plants laden with snow.
